Eagle Mountain House Offers Variety
This hotel provides a casual restaurant that offers many choices to meet the needs of its hotel guests.

In addition to an extensive menu offering appetizers, soups, salads, sandwiches, entrees, nightly specials and desserts; the wine list is basic and affordable.

The Sunday champagne brunch is a good value and is probably the best in the entire White Mountains. This restaurant serves breakfast daily and is a sure bet before teeing off at the hotel's golf course which is just across the road!

While service is very friendly, the staff can be inattentive at times.    [24 Jun 2006 07:46:42]

Food: ****   Service: ***   Ambiance: ****   Overall: ***
Recommended Dishes: Mac & Lobster appetizer; Steak & Shrimp; Lobster Pie; New England Duckling

Going Home...
This was our third visit to the Eagle Mountain House in the past two years. We are happy to report this restaurant continues to improve itself.

We find dining at Highfields often provides us with an extraordinary value for our money. Thursday evening is what we call "locals night" and recently we enjoyed a great four-course Italian dinner for only $14.95!

And then on Friday night we had their Steak & Shrimp dinner for TWO which was only $25.95!

And in both instances, these dinner were not skimpy little portions...rather, very good food an incredible price.

But we have to be honest and say our favorite still is their incredible Sunday Champagne Brunch. We have seen an even great selection of desserts...though we rarely have much room left for them, especially with a long drive back to the City. Brunch now offers more diverse live music which is very enjoyable, as well.

Bottom line, the Eagle Mountain House's Highfields dining room is a great destination...for couples and families!    [21 Sep 2007 11:09:34]
